Welcome to East Bethany ...East Bethany is located in Genesee County<1>. While we don't have a date for the founding of East Bethany, you might consider that their post office opened in 1825. A typical abbreviation for East Bethany: E. Bethany East Bethany is 1,000 feet [305 m] above sea level.<2>.
